Your charitable assistance is needed!
I am writing to tell you about a fun loving baseball opportunity for charitable minded baseball lovers in Pittsburgh.
On May 15 - our nonprofit, Community Human Services, is holding a "Take Me Out to the Baseball Game" Fundraiser to raise funds for low-income kids to attend an 8 week summer day camp this year.
Each person that pays the $50 admission fee will receive free food, a drink (alcoholic in nature) and access to a fantastic auction at UGLY's restaurant on the Northside from 5 PM to 7 PM.
After socializing, each participant will walk across the street and watch the ball game, in the left grand stand, at PNC Park to watch the Pirates beat the Rockies.
This fun evening filled with food, drink, socializing and ball game...will pay for one very low income child to attend one week of summer camp at CHS. It's a win-win-win situation all the way around!
